The Good, The Bad, The Weird

Directed by Ji-woon Kim

No run of the mill spaghetti ‘eastern’, respected director Ji-woon Kim (A Tale of Two Sisters) provides an exhilarating ride with Korea’s three top male stars storming through 1930s Manchuria after hidden treasure. This Korean film is a must see on the big screen.

Reviews

“East meets West meets East again, with palate-tingling results, in The Good, The Bad, The Weird a kimchi Western that draws shamelessly on its spaghetti forebears but remains utterly, bracingly Korean.” Derek Elley, Variety

“If Sergio Leone could see The Good, The Bad, The Weird, a gleefully deranged Korean homage to his spaghetti westerns, he would probably envy the resources available to director Ji-woon Kim” Wendy Ide, The Times

“[…] fluid, dizzying camera moves and judicious CGI, ravishing set design and exhilarating action. ****” Kim Jee-Woon, Time Out (London)
